Our web hosting company was sold in April.
The new owners tried to stop "spam" attacks on their servers by
setting eveybody's email to ":fail" . This caused two weeks of mail to be
rejected. They finally corrected this with a more complex way to access e-mail.
During this period, the Institute Forum was vandalized. Recovery of the Forum from
backups resulted in a security violation.
After almost a month of trying, we put up a new Forum.
It took 6-days to get an answer to an FTP Virus that may have been the why that our
Forum was vandalized.
The answer was : it is not a virus, it just has the behavior of one.
Early in June all the email account-names of the members of the Institute were erased.
Each of us thought that questions were going to another. We lost another week of e-mail.
The Institute will move to a new ISP in the near future.
There should be no change in what you see. It just will work properly.[/list]
